Question
State the significance of binding energy per nucleon.
Solution
- It enables us to compare the relative strengths with which nucleolus are bound in a nucleus for various species, and thus their stability.
- Nuclei with greater EB/A ratios are more stable than nuclei with lower levels of this quantity.
